If we reivew the current memory metrics in Perf c2c tool, it doesn't orgnize the metrics with directive approach; thus user needs to take time to dig into every statistics item. On the other hand, if use the "summary and breakdown" approach, the output result will be easier for reviewing by users, e.g. the output result can firstly give out the summary values, and then the later items will breakdown into more detailed statistics. For this reason, this patch is to reorgnize the metrics and it only changes for the "Shared Data Cache Line Table": it firstly displays the summary values for total records, total loads, total stores; then it breaks these summary values into small values, with the order from the most near memory node ("CPU Load Hit") to more far nodes ("LLC Load Hit", "RMT Load Hit", "Load Dram"). "LLC Load Hit" = "LclHit" + "LclHitm" "RMT Load Hit" = "RmtHit" + "RmtHitm" \ -> LLC Load Miss "Load Dram" = "Lcl" + "Rmt" / Another main reason for this patch set is wanting to extend "perf c2c" to support Arm SPE memory event, but Arm SPE doesn't contain 'HTIM' tag in its default trace data, for this case if want to analyze cache false sharing issue, we need to rely on LLC metrics + multi-threading info. So this patch set can be friendly to show LLC related metrics in the "Shared Data Cache Line Table"; for sorting cache lines with LLC metrics which will be sent out with another separate patch set.
